Let’s start with local real estate trends. Every city in India, from Delhi to Chennai, has its own unique property market influenced by economic growth, population, and new infrastructure. For example, property investment in Hyderabad has grown due to the city’s booming IT sector, while Noida is gaining attention with new metro lines and the upcoming Jewar Airport. Real estate market analysis helps you spot these trends, guiding you to invest in localities with high rental yields or potential for capital appreciation.
Next, let’s talk about risk. No investment is without risk, especially when it comes to property investment in India. Some areas, like Gurgaon or Thane, have consistently high demand for residential projects thanks to their thriving job markets. Others might face challenges like oversupply or poor connectivity. With a thorough real estate market analysis, you can compare different locations and property types—such as commercial spaces, luxury apartments, or affordable housing—to make safer choices for your real estate portfolio.

Have you ever considered investing in emerging property markets?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ities like Lucknow, Surat, and Indore are now becoming real estate hotspots. Urban development, new highways, and smart city projects are creating fresh opportunities for real estate investors. By using market analysis, you can discover these up-and-coming areas before they become mainstream, whether you’re interested in residential plots, office spaces, or premium flats.
So, what do you need to look at during your real estate market analysis? Start with supply and demand. Are there more buyers than properties in a certain area? This could push property prices higher and improve your chances of rental income or resale profits. Economic indicators are also key—think about job opportunities, average income, and business growth in the area. These factors can affect the demand for both residential and commercial properties.
Don’t forget about the regulatory environment. Staying updated on RERA compliance and other government guidelines is essential for anyone interested in real estate investment in India. Properties that follow legal norms are safer bets, whether you’re buying, selling, or renting.
Infrastructure growth is another big factor. New developments like metro stations, highways, and shopping malls can turn an average locality into a prime real estate location. For instance, Greater Noida’s real estate market is buzzing with the construction of the Jewar Airport, attracting investors looking for commercial and residential projects alike.
